Event description

“If 25 was my time to thrive, 26 is a bag of d#cks.”

Ally Morgan can barely ride a skateboard, let alone navigate the ups and downs of her 20s. As if losing her job wasn’t enough, she battles constant climate anxiety and an increasing awareness of her own mortality. So, she muddles through the messiness of life the best way she knows how.

By singing really loud about it.

An intimate cabaret experience, Not Today is a frank, funny, and emotion-charged song cycle about trying to make the most of life, while you can. Featuring an entirely original score, Ally will take you on a bumpy ride through life as a not-yet-famous 26-year-old.

The song cycle features twelve of Ally’s smart, fun, and insightful pieces, including the titular “Not Today”, following one queer young's woman story as she comes to terms with her sexuality, climate anxiety, and her own mortality.

It’s a heartfelt and sometimes hilariously sarcastic journey into the hopes and dreams of a millennial-in-progress.

“We are here, and we will die someday, but not today.”

Not Today is presented by Rogue Projects as part of the KXT POPUPSTAIRS program with thanks to KXT and the KX Hotel, and the support of the City of Sydney.
